这是社区版回归与大家见面的第一个版本,在新版本 v1.5.0 中,CloudQuery 主要功能包括以下几个模块:
统一数据库管理
数据库纳管支持
完善 SQL 编辑器
数据源操作权限
时间权限设置
受限资源权限设置
数据导出权限
增加流程模块
查看审计日志
系统监控功能
01
统一数据库管理
CloudQuery 作为一体化数据库操作管控平台,始终将数据库的统一高效管理视作核心功能和竞争力。这次回归进一步完善了该功能,具体包括:
● 支持统一管控下,对数据库、表、函数、存储过程、DBLINK、包、包体、序列、触发器等十多种数据库对象的创建与编辑;
● 编辑时,支持图形可视化操作。用户可以在图形化界面创建表、索引、触发器、对表结构进行变更、对表数据进行增删改查,操作方式与传统客户端保持一致,快速上手;
● 导入文件时,支持EXCEL、CSV、TXT等文件的数据导入,支持自定义分隔符。
02
数据库纳管支持
v1.5.0 是不同于以往的全新社区版本,目前支持6种数据源,Oracle、OracleCDB、SQLServer、MySQL、PostgreSQL和MariaDB。
● OracleCDB 与 Oracle 相比,增加了PDB层级
● CloudQuery 社区版目前支持纳管的实例数上限为100个
03
完善SQL 编辑器
新版本完善了 SQL 编辑器的部分功能:
● 支持SQL语句智能提示、关键词高亮显示、执行计划、事务、SQL美化(包括大小写转换、格式化、折叠/展开、放大/缩小字体)
● 支持全部执行或选中执行,并支持查看执行计划
● 支持编辑器内容收藏至文件或从文件加载
04
数据源操作权限
● v1.5.0 增强了权限管控的细粒度,目前权限管控可精确到字段级别
● 完善了对操作对象、操作类型、操作时间、影响行数、操作次数等多因素的管控,限制越权操作和高危操作
05
时间权限设置
与之前的版本相比,CloudQuery 社区版 v1.5.0 支持自定义执行 SQL 语句的操作时间,实现更细粒度的管控。
06
受限资源权限设置
v1.5.0 支持自定义高危操作,高危提权复核方式支持同步复核。
07
数据导出权限
● v1.5.0 新增了数据导出权限,可设置导出权限的权限名称、权限描述,选择对应数据库元素;可针对单条权限进行编辑、删除操作。
08
增加流程模块
v1.5.0 相比之前的版本,增加了流程申请和审批模块,主要功能包括:
● 当普通用户需要某些权限时,支持向管理员发起流程申请,权限管控更加灵活;
● 支持查看申请详情,包括申请人、时间、操作类型等;
● 支持管理员设计流程,将审批自定义为一级/二级审批,也支持选择审批人;
● 支持管理员管理流程,如将审批进行转审。
09
查看审计日志
最新版本更新了审计功能。CloudQuery 会记录使用过程中的语句明细和操作明细,在以下功能上进行了升级:
● 支持查看平台执行SQL次数、错误数、数据库使用占比、以及活跃用户数等
● 支持查看SQL操作信息明细,包括操作语句、执行计划、关联权限等
● 支持自定义查询结果字段展示、按条件筛选语句信息明细
● 支持点击用户名或数据库对象进入相应的审计核界面
● 支持查看平台用户操作明细,包括用户名、用户角色、客户端、操作类型等
10
系统监控功能
● 主机监控
CloudQuery v1.5.0 具备主机监控功能,可对自身平台所在服务器运行状态进行监控,查看CPU使用率与总体率、分区状态、流量状态等。
● 容器监控
新版本使用 docker 容器进行安装部署,每个服务拥有独立容器环境,同时支持对容器运行状态进行监控,及时查看服务运行状态。
更丰富的功能欢迎大家点击文末阅读原文或搜索 https://cloudquery.club/#/ 进入官网,下载使用!
此外,为了更直观具体地为大家讲解新版本的功能和理念,我们即将于 4月19日 在墨天轮、微信视频号、bilibili 同步进行一场发版直播,伙伴们可以扫描二维码预约观看!直播中还会不定时发布抽奖,欢迎大家积极参与!
墨天轮
bilibili
大家在使用过程中有任何疑问和建议,欢迎扫码添加 CloudQuery 官方小助手微信进入社区群,我们期待收到您的反馈!